Is modesty a virtue? If you are young boxer grappling for big fights and public recognition, then the answer to that question is a definite no. Spouting poetry and predicting the round in which his opponents would fall, Cassius Clay (aka Muhammad Ali) arrived on the scene in 1960 with a bang and over the better part of two decades essentially transformed the ‘sweet science’ from a sport into an entertainment industry. As such, marketability is now the name of the game. [details (http://www.boxingscene.com/?m=show&id=1248)]
